2019 is promising to be an amazing year with most of the National Conventions being held on the Western side of the country. In April, the Sn3 Symposium lands in Seattle, Washington. In May, the O Scale National Convention is being hosted by O Scale West in Santa Clara, California. July brings the NMRA National Convention in Salt Lake City, Utah. The National Garden Railway Convention will be in Portland, Oregon in late August. (The blue event links will take you to their respective websites.)
One week later, the 39th National Narrow Gauge Convention is being held in Sacramento, California. In addition to these model railroad conventions, the 150th celebration of the completion of the Transcontinental Railroad will be held in May in Utah. With the Garden Convention and the Narrow Gauge Convention being held one week apart, you have the opportunity to attend both conventions.
